About Daniela Paddeu

Daniela Paddeu is a scholar working on Building and Construction, Automotive Engineering, Industrial and Manufacturing Engineering, Marketing and Transportation, having authored 23 papers that have together received 528 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Urban and Freight Transport Logistics (12 papers), Transportation and Mobility Innovations (10 papers), Maritime Ports and Logistics (9 papers), Sharing Economy and Platforms (5 papers), Transportation Planning and Optimization (5 papers), Human-Automation Interaction and Safety (4 papers), Consumer Retail Behavior Studies (3 papers) and Sustainable Supply Chain Management (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Transportation (159 citations), Automotive Engineering (261 citations), Building and Construction (181 citations), Industrial and Manufacturing Engineering (130 citations) and Marketing (117 citations). Daniela Paddeu has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, Italy and Greece. Frequent co-authors include Graham Parkhurst, Ian Shergold, Paolo Fadda, Gianfranco Fancello, Miriam Ricci, Paulus Aditjandra, John Parkin, William Clayton, Amalia Polydoropoulou and Thomas Calvert. Their work appears in journals such as Research in Transportation Economics, Transport Policy, Transport, Futures and Transportation Planning and Technology.
